Ronald Harling Maudsley (8 April 1918 – 29 September 1981) was an English professor of law who for a few seasons played first-class cricket.[1] As a cricketer, he was a middle-order right-handed batsman and a right-arm medium-pace bowler who played for Oxford University and Warwickshire between 1946 and 1951. He was captain of Warwickshire in 1948. As a law professor, he held posts at universities in Oxford, London, New York and San Diego. He was born in Lostock Gralam, Cheshire, and died at San Diego, California.
